Output 658d04280c43f09346c5b9b12bcb41fe8609c780ab460246bf9bc9cbdb399655:83

value
2583206
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16d3b0b363e67f0319d748f88e5cf9103b64bcce OP_EQUAL
address
33miPG1SAeE9cGS9dTPTkeBzMV9EfZ1HSL
transaction
658d04280c43f09346c5b9b12bcb41fe8609c780ab460246bf9bc9cbdb399655
spent
true